Tomorrow will mark the most important round for Tiger 2.0 he has had to date. He is in a position (54 hole lead) where he was all but impenetrable prior to 2009. If he is able to close things out tomorrow he would obviously be a favorite at Augusta. If he doesn't he will still be a favorite to contend at Augusta but a win would likely boost the confidence level sky high. I don't have any predictions but will be interested to watch. But he needs something we haven't seen much of except for the Honda - a strong Sunday round. I give him a 50-50 shot.
